Sonic Unleashed Unofficial PC Port is Now Available for Download
An unofficial PC port of Sonic Unleashed is now available for download, allowing PC users to experience the PS3/Xbox 360 era entry in the series natively with some visual improvements and additional features not available in the original releases. The Unleashed Recompiled port, which can be downloaded from here and requires a copy of the Xbox 360 version of the game, has been created through the process of static recompilation and features no original assets whatsoever, which should make it safe from any takedown from SEGA.
